Understanding Water Softener Expenses: A Detailed Look
When contemplating a water softener for your home, it's crucial to evaluate the associated costs. These expenses can vary significantly depending on factors such as the size of your household, the hardness of your water, and the type of system you select.
Initial installation costs typically range from approximately one thousand dollars, while ongoing operational costs, including salt replenishment and occasional maintenance, can amount to roughly one hundred dollars per year.
- Moreover, it's essential to factor in the potential savings on soap, detergents, and appliances that result from using soft water.
- In conclusion, a thorough cost analysis can help you determine if a water softener is a wise investment for your home.

Choosing the Right Water Softener: Budget & Features Guide
Hard water can be a pain on your home's plumbing and appliances. A water softener can mitigate this issue, leaving you with soft, clean water. But with numerous options available, choosing the right water softener can feel overwhelming.
This guide will help you understand the realm of water softeners, taking into consideration both your budget and essential features. First, determine your household's water hardness level and daily water usage to get an idea of the size you need.
- Next, consider your budget. Water softeners range in price from a few hundred dollars for basic models to several thousand dollars for high-end systems.
- Examine features like salt type, regeneration cycle, and control options. Some water softeners even offer remote monitoring for added ease of use.
By thoughtfully considering these factors, you can discover the perfect water softener to fulfill your needs and enjoy the benefits of soft water in your home.
